Over 2.7 billion years ago, cyanobacteria first produced oxygen using chlorophyll, a molecule essential for nearly all life on Earth. This critical green pigment, which allows plants to convert sunlight into energy, has become a hot topic in the health and wellness world, but what do you need to know about chlorophyll beyond its function in photosynthesis?
